Transaction e73c8daa15e84510dd693e6c825d75b44628753b143a534b5e75d67caca690d5
1 Input
1 Output
-
e73c8daa15e84510dd693e6c825d75b44628753b143a534b5e75d67caca690d5:0
- value
- 526368
- script pubkey
- OP_0 OP_PUSHBYTES_20 eff8c48ef94e63cc73a28419109881d40b119d01
- address
- bc1qaluvfrhefe3ucuazssv3pxyp6s93r8gptqc8xx